What is a Conservatory?

A conservatory is a glass-enclosed structure, frequently attached to a home, created to offer a space for relaxation, socializing, and taking pleasure in nature without being exposed to the aspects. Traditionally, conservatories were made entirely of glass, however modern styles incorporate numerous products, consisting of wood and aluminum, to improve insulation and durability.

Elements to Consider Before Installation

When planning a conservatory installation, a number of factors should be taken into consideration:

  1. Budget: Determine how much you're prepared to spend, consisting of installation expenses and ongoing upkeep.
  2. Planning Permissions: Check local guidelines to guarantee compliance with building regulations.
  3. Orientation: Consider the direction your conservatory deals with for ideal sunlight and heat retention.
  4. Design: Choose a design that matches your home's existing architecture.
  5. Materials: Select products that offer sturdiness and insulation while aligning with your budget plan.

Steps in the Conservatory Installation Process

The installation procedure can be broken down into the following phases:

StepDescription
Initial ConsultationDiscuss your requirements and budget plan with an installation expert.
Website SurveyA professional will assess your property for expediency.
Design ApprovalComplete the conservatory design and get required approvals.
Preparation of SitePrepare the website, which may include clearing and leveling.
Structure WorkLay the structure based on the conservatory type.
Frame InstallationBuild the frame, normally made from uPVC, wood, or aluminum.
GlazingInstall glass panels or other materials for walls and roofing.
Internal FinishingMake sure correct insulation, electrics, and interior styling.
Final InspectionHave the installation checked to ensure quality and compliance.

Expense of Conservatory Installation

The cost of setting up a conservatory can differ significantly based upon several aspects, including size, products utilized, and complexity of design. Here's a basic introduction:

Type of ConservatoryEstimated Cost
Lean-To₤ 5,000 - ₤ 15,000
Victorian₤ 10,000 - ₤ 25,000
Edwardian₤ 10,000 - ₤ 20,000
Gable Front₤ 12,000 - ₤ 30,000
P-shaped₤ 15,000 - ₤ 40,000

Keep in mind: Prices may differ based on area and specific requirements.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Do I need planning approval for a conservatory?

In a lot of cases, conservatories fall under allowed advancement rights, which implies they might not require preparation permission. However, this can vary based upon local policies, especially for larger structures or if your home is listed. Constantly consult your local council.

2. The length of time does the installation process take?

The installation period can differ based upon the intricacy and size of the conservatory, generally varying from a couple of weeks to a couple of months. Preliminary assessments and design stages can extend this timeline.

3. What is the very best kind of conservatory for my property?

The very best type depends upon your home's architecture, the intended use, and your spending plan. Consulting a professional installer can assist you decide the very best suitable for your needs.

4. Will a conservatory require maintenance?

Yes, conservatories need routine maintenance, consisting of cleansing glass panels, inspecting seals, and making sure proper drainage. Products like uPVC and aluminum typically require less maintenance compared to wood.

5. Can I utilize my conservatory year-round?

With proper insulation and climate control functions, conservatories need to be usable year-round. It's necessary to pick good-quality glazing and insulation to keep comfortable temperatures.
